Something Clients Want

Architect Paul Revere Williams has designed some of the most imposing houses in California's glossy Beverly Hills, but he cannot live there himself. He has designed a score of luxury hotels and swank spas, but he knows that few would welcome him as a guest. As one of Los Angeles' top five architects, he could afford a mansion, but he lives in a somewhat rundown part of town. Paul Williams is a Negro.
